Transaction c4efdc7dc6d0300be1817c740f2378535eaac83cf6deecc72a21d999d15720da
1 Input
1 Output
-
c4efdc7dc6d0300be1817c740f2378535eaac83cf6deecc72a21d999d15720da:0
- value
- 20020487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b30ba2d07f7bf0076eb84cb38372fc470ee9275 OP_EQUAL
- address
- 3LDPU7ZhpuBcJF3whWfeAKxtvVAh2dkhcr